Gnophos sartata
Gnophos is a genus in the geometer moth family (Geometridae). A mostly Old World lineage, it is abundant in the Palearctic, with some North American species as well; in Europe six species are recorded. Gnophos sartata is probably the most common in Greece. Spotted in Volos city.
